European Parliament wants back €4M it says far-right group misspent – POLITICO


The EU’s public prosecutor (EPPO) confirmed to POLITICO that it is conducting its own investigation into mismanagement of funds.

Public contracts for friconcludes and irregular donations

The alleged misspconcludeing relates to the budreceive allocated annually by the Parliament for political groups to spconclude on administrative and operative costs, as well as political and information activities related to its work, known in Parliament lingo as “budreceive item 400.”

The financial audit, first reported by Le Monde, states the group breached the public tconcludeer rules when awarding contracts for advertisements, community management, and printing services in several companies in Austria, France, and Germany, totaling about €3,598,803.

“The tconcludeer procedure was conducted as a purely formal exercise, without revealing the intent to have a choice of offers to select the best possible provider,” the report states.

The report also alleges public contracts may have been awarded to companies friconcludely to the party.

In one case, contracts for ads in an Austrian magazine were directly awarded to a company led by a former MEP of the Austrian FPÖ party, a member of the ID group and current member of Patriots, the report states.
